CS8021/CS8026 - Quad/Dual EPON OLT Chip

The Cortina Systems® CS8021 Quad Gigabit Ethernet Passive Optical Network (GEPON or EPON) Optical Line Terminal (OLT) chip (CS8021) supports four EPON ports in a single chip to significantly simplify board design and lower the system Bill of Materials (BOM) cost. The CS8021 enables equipment vendors to develop a high port density chassis or stackable rack mount system targeted at the Central Office (CO).

The Cortina CS8026 Dual Gigabit Ethernet Passive Optical Network (GEPON or EPON) Optical Line Terminal (OLT) chip (CS8026) supports 2 EPON ports in a single chip for vendors needing only a dual port design.

 

Features and Benefits

EPON Protocol

• Implements standard-compliant Ethernet Multi-point MAC control functions specified in IEEE 802.3ah

• Supports complete processing and generation of MPCP control messages

• Emulates point-to-point link between each ONU and OLT using LLID (logical link identifier)

• Supports single-copy-broadcast (SCB)

• Supports ONU-to-ONU communication and emulates LAN service using layer 2 MAC address

• Supports standard based as well as vendor specific registration and deregistration process

Ethernet OAM Management

• Implements complete IEEE 802.3ah OAM functions

• Supports bridge/Ethernet MIBs

• Supports EFM MIB

• Supports EFM OAM MIB

• Supports remote ONU management
